Merge master into the line B review stack (V-405)

The two open lines never met: line A landed through #168, so every pull
request from #148 to #160 conflicted with master on six files. This
reconciles them.

Where the two lines fixed the same thing, the better shape wins:

- Ambient time zones (V-482) landed on both sides. Keeps the injectable
  EventFromNotificationIn from this line, plus master's rationale comment.
  Drops master's forced n.Posted.In(time.Local), which defeated the loc
  argument.
- tick.go: master's guardNudge call and say.CountWord edits, moved onto the
  split files this line created. The digest summary now declines through
  say.CountWord inside tick_digest.go.
- voice.go: master's topicIndex field joins recallWiring rather than the
  handler, since it is embedder-backed recall like the personal boundary.
  topics.go and its test read h.recall.topics now.
- mavweb: master's capability and risk columns ported into tools.html, which
  is where this line moved the markup. The Go const is gone.
- Three new store sentinels for list items get the same verdicts the task
  sentinels already carry, in unmappedStoreErrors.

make build: 12 binaries. make test: green. make fmt-check: clean.
